What is hidden frame glass curtain wall?

图片
    A hidden frame glass curtain wall refers to a modern architectural design where the structural framework supporting the glass panels is concealed, creating a seamless and minimalist appearance. This type of curtain wall system is often used in contemporary buildings to achieve a sleek and aesthetically pleasing exterior. Here are key features and characteristics of a hidden frame glass curtain wall: 1. Structural Concealment: The defining feature of a  hidden frame glass curtain wall   is the concealment of the structural framework behind the glass panels. This creates a clean and unobstructed visual effect, emphasizing transparency and modern design. 2. Minimalist Aesthetics: Hidden frame curtain walls contribute to a minimalist aesthetic, promoting an open and airy feel in both the interior and exterior of a building. How Does a Hydraulic Press Work?

图片
  If you work in an industrial environment, you may well have come across a   Hydraulic Press   before. This piece of equipment is used in a variety of different operations, such as pressing metallic objects into a sheet of metal, thinning glass, crushing cars and making powders. A hydraulic press can be used to suit the needs of most industrial environments.     So, how does a hydraulic press work?  A hydraulic press contains two cylinders which are connected to one another. Each cylinder contains hydraulic fluid and one cylinder is larger than the other. The larger cylinder is known as the  Ram  and the smaller one is known as the  Plunger .  Liquids do not compress easily, which is why they are used in a hydraulic press. The hydraulic press works by pressing a small amount of force onto the Plunger which presses the fluid below. This pressure is then distributed evenly which in turn raises the Ram.
